Quality Control and Assurance in Ingredient Manufacturing
Within the intricate realm of ingredient manufacturing, guaranteeing quality is paramount. A robust system of quality control safeguards against deviations throughout the production process. This involves meticulous inspection at each stage, from raw material sourcing to final product dispatch.
Strict adherence to formulated standards ensures that ingredients meet rigorous criteria for purity, potency, and safety. Implementing advanced analytical techniques and cutting-edge equipment allows manufacturers to detect even the slightest abnormalities. A comprehensive quality management system, encompassing documentation, training, and ongoing optimization initiatives, is crucial read more for sustaining exceptional quality in ingredient manufacturing.
Trendsetting Trends in Food Ingredient Formulation
The food industry is a dynamic landscape constantly transforming to meet changing consumer demands. One significant area of focus is ingredient formulation, where innovative trends are influencing the future of what we eat. Consumers are increasingly seeking healthier, more sustainable, and delicious options. This has motivated manufacturers to explore novel ingredient solutions that cater these evolving needs.
- One prominent trend is the growth of plant-based ingredients, driven by growing concerns about animal consumption and its environmental impact.
- A separate notable trend is the integration of functional ingredients that offer health benefits, such as probiotics.
- Additionally, there is a trend towards more natural sourcing practices and the reduction of artificial additives.
These emerging trends in food ingredient formulation are altering the way we produce, consume, and perceive food.
International Market Analysis of Processed Food Ingredients
The global market for processed food ingredients is a booming industry driven by rising consumer demand for prepared foods. This shift is fueled by factors such as hectic lifestyles, rising urbanization rates, and evolving dietary preferences. The industry is characterized by a extensive range of ingredients, including seasonings, enhancers, stabilizers, and nutritional supplements. Key companies in this market are spending heavily in development to create new and innovative ingredients that meet the evolving requirements of consumers.
The sector is also experiencing considerable development in emerging economies. This growth is driven by factors such as rising disposable incomes, urbanization, and a preference for processed foods.
The future of the processed food ingredients market looks positive. Continued development in technology is expected to drive further development and generate new avenues for players in this booming industry.
